Deviled Sandwiches

(Sandwiches) - (Sandwiches)







Chop a quarter of a pound of cold, boiled tongue very fine; add to it

two tablespoonfuls of olive oil, a dash of red pepper, a teaspoonful of

Worcestershire sauce, and a saltspoonful of paprika; mix and add the

hard-boiled yolks of three eggs that have been pressed through a sieve.

Put this between thin slices of bread and butter, and garnish with water

cress.
